Delco Remy endows $5K for America's Best scholarships

The heavy-duty electrical system supplier contributes to the program, which provides financial assistance to qualifying techs and inspectors to attend the competition. This year's competition will be held in Jasper, Ind., Sept 28 through Oct. 1.

Delco Remy has endowed $5,000 for the 2010 America's Best Scholarship Program, providing financial assistance for qualifying technicians and inspectors to attend the national competition.

The National Association for Pupil Transportation (NAPT) and the National School Bus Inspection Council sponsor the nationwide search for America’s Best school bus technician and inspector.

Participants in the competition must complete a written evaluation of their knowledge. In addition, technicians complete a diagnostics test, and inspectors perform an inspection. The competition is integrated with workshops covering school bus components and systems.

This year, the seventh annual competition will take place at Jasper Engines & Transmissions in Jasper, Ind., Sept. 28 through Oct. 1.

To qualify for an America's Best Scholarship:

  1. The competitor must have met all qualifications as described in the America's Best rules and must be a winning competitor in their local state competition or chosen by an authorized state committee as their representative to America's Best.

  2. All submissions for scholarship funds must include estimated cost for travel expenses and lodging to attend America's Best.

  3. All applications must be submitted to the America's Best Scholarship Committee (ABSC) for review and evaluation at least 45 days prior to the competition. Application deadline: Aug. 13, 2010. For the application form, click here.

  4. The ABSC will review all applicants and notify scholarship winners at least 30 days prior to the competition.

  5. Only one scholarship will be awarded per state/per sponsor.

  6. All awards as determined by the ABSC shall be final.

Scholarships are designated to cover the anticipated cost for a competitor to attend and participate in America's Best. Associated costs that will be considered are travel expenses (car, airfare, lodging, etc.) for the competitor only.

The ABSC will comprise one NAPT board member, two America's Best Committee members and a scholarship sponsor representative.
